
Enemies of Peace Won’t Be Happy to See Peace in J&K: Altaf Bukhari
The recent terrorist attack in Pahalgam, Jammu and Kashmir, has left the nation in shock. The attack, which claimed the lives of at least 26 people, is a stark reminder of the ongoing struggle for peace and stability in the region. Amidst the chaos and grief, Altaf Bukhari, the President of Apni Party, Jammu and Kashmir, has spoken out against the attack, emphasizing the need to learn from such incidents.
Bukhari, in a statement, condemned the attack, labeling it as a “murder of humanity.” He emphasized that those who are enemies of peace will never be happy to see peace prevail in the region. This is a sentiment that resonates deeply with the people of Jammu and Kashmir, who have suffered immensely at the hands of terrorism and violence.
